Senior Police Inspector Purushottam Gawande on Thursday said, “Last night, when our mobile patrol van was patrolling the area near Charkop market, the officers came across two teenagers trying to go somewhere in a hurry. While they were boarding an autorickshaw, one of our officers saw a bulge at the back of one of the youth. Getting suspicious, when our officers tried to accost them, the two tried to flee but were chased and nabbed. We recovered a chopper from one of them and also saw that their shirts were blood-stained.”
Gawande said when the two youths were being interrogated, the station got a call from a private hospital, Mangalmurty Nursing Home, that they had admitted an injured teenager. “When we went to the hospital, we found the victim, one Vitthal Kadam lying in an injured state. When asked, he told us about being assaulted by two youths, whose names and descriptions matched the two apprehended by our officers,” Gawande said.
After further interrogation of the duo, it was revealed that Vitthal Kadam, the son of constable Rajendra Kadam attached to the Kherwadi police station and residing at Sector 2 in Charkop, had been befriended by the two accused, both residents of the nearby Bhabre Nagar, Gawande said.
“Both the accused were in the habit of drinking toddy and used to frequently take Vitthal with them to drink. Vithal’s father disapproved of this association and had scolded Vitthal and the other two on many occasions. The two arrested probably nursed a grudge against Vitthal on this account. On Wednesday night, the two again called up Vitthal and told him to meet them at an isolated under-construction site at Sector 8. There, they made him drink toddy and when he was sufficiently inebriated, they assaulted him with chopper on his face, neck and hands before making way with his gold chain, mobile phone and some petty cash,” Gawande said.
The two arrested have been charged with robbery and attempt to murder, he said.
